79 lines
4.6 KiB
Markdown
79 lines
4.6 KiB
Markdown
# Session: 2026-06-25 16:45:37 GMT+8
|
||
|
||
- **Session Key**: agent:main:feishu:direct:ou_e63ce6b760ad39382852472f28fbe2a2
|
||
- **Session ID**: 76217dcf-0b9b-45d3-8d48-42655ccbf42e
|
||
- **Source**: feishu
|
||
|
||
## Conversation Summary
|
||
|
||
assistant: 好的,我来查一下所有用户的 open_id 和 user_id 对应关系,然后把 USER.md 补齐。
|
||
|
||
先确认一下当前需要补全的用户:
|
||
- 有 `ou_` 但缺 `user_id` 的:王虹茗、许悦、你(李承龙在 AGENTS.md 审批规则里用的 `ou_`)
|
||
- 有 `user_id` 但缺 `ou_` 的:陈逸鸫、曲慧萌、吴迪、李玉、刘庆逊、胡陈辰、刘彦江、姜小龙、赵一凡、李丹、梁音、刘新玉、李若松、张昆鹏
|
||
|
||
我先用 lark-identify-sender 的能力来查询这些用户的双向 ID。
|
||
assistant: 好的,我已经找到了大部分人的 user_id。现在需要查一下那几个只有 `ou_` 开头 open_id 的用户对应的 user_id,以及反过来查已有 user_id 用户的 open_id。
|
||
|
||
从用户列表里已确认:
|
||
- 王虹茗 user_id = `af61e4gc`
|
||
- 许悦 user_id = `ae8b8b7f`
|
||
- 李承龙 user_id = `d8cb7f2a`
|
||
|
||
现在我需要通过 API 查询所有人的 open_id。让我批量查一下:
|
||
assistant: 查到了大部分人的 open_id。有 6 个人返回 N/A(陈逸鸫、吴迪、李玉、姜小龙、李丹、梁音),可能是因为这些用户不在小溪 Bot 的可见范围内。让我换个方式试试,用 batch API 查:
|
||
assistant: 这 6 个人的错误是 `no user authority error`,说明小溪 Bot 没有查看这些用户的通讯录权限(他们可能不在 Bot 的可见范围内)。不过没关系,我先把已经查到的信息更新到 USER.md,查不到的标注"待补全"。
|
||
|
||
现在来更新 USER.md:
|
||
assistant: 现在我来更新 USER.md,把所有用户的 ID 补全为双列(user_id + open_id):
|
||
assistant: The issue is that the file has specific formatting. Let me try with the exact text from the file:
|
||
assistant: 现在让我验证一下最终结果:
|
||
assistant: 已完成更新。现在修复一下技术负责人群组那行的表格格式(多了一列,会导致表格渲染异常):
|
||
assistant: 好的,USER.md 已经更新完毕。来汇总一下结果:
|
||
|
||
---
|
||
|
||
**已完成更新,USER.md 现在同时保留 user_id 和 open_id 两列:**
|
||
|
||
✅ **已成功补全双向 ID 的用户(11人):**
|
||
|
||
| 姓名 | user_id | open_id |
|
||
|------|---------|---------|
|
||
| 李承龙 | `d8cb7f2a` | `ou_e63ce6b760ad39382852472f28fbe2a2` |
|
||
| 李若松 | `4aagb443` | `ou_9cb5bc9a5f1b6cab2d78fd36139ecb87` |
|
||
| 张昆鹏 | `7f5cd711` | `ou_0ddd623aa4a0964a2119b5939236b6bf` |
|
||
| 王虹茗 | `af61e4gc` | `ou_7ef247331804edf255f53e3be15963f4` |
|
||
| 曲慧萌 | `8c654e1e` | `ou_45c9fb014cadf6cf38964162e026e11b` |
|
||
| 刘庆逊 | `cb2815b4` | `ou_e97f5e52a82975738c7ecc1a4903eb15` |
|
||
| 胡陈辰 | `gc64176a` | `ou_54a8602be0093517a673268aded54599` |
|
||
| 刘彦江 | `1da2afbf` | `ou_b45bb189b1253f04c84ef6832e0875da` |
|
||
| 赵一凡 | `a3168f9d` | `ou_13f70b43d99dc634d484ac7ebc4ef670` |
|
||
| 许悦 | `ae8b8b7f` | `ou_9fa20071e6ee1b3e1e74805616f3f5cb` |
|
||
| 刘新玉 | `7gc796ga` | `ou_d156bc8137d8a80e7f013ef0a59d6d96` |
|
||
|
||
⚠️ **6人的 open_id 暂时无法查到(标记"待补全"):**
|
||
- 陈逸鸫、吴迪、李玉、姜小龙、李丹、梁音
|
||
|
||
原因是小溪 Bot 的通讯录权限范围没覆盖到这几位用户(API 返回 `no user authority error`)。可能需要在飞书开发者后台把这些人加入 Bot 的可见范围,或者让技术负责人用其他有完整通讯录权限的 Bot 查一下补上。
|
||
user: [message_id: om_x100b6cfdea6a50a0b1fe31a6bb6f04d]
|
||
李承龙: 删除user.md中陈逸鸫的权限
|
||
assistant: 已删除陈逸鸫的权限记录。她现在属于"第三级:其他用户",如果再来查数据会先通知你确认。
|
||
user: [message_id: om_x100b6cfd8e194488b2614125aa6578d]
|
||
李承龙: 补充:
|
||
吴迪
|
||
ou_424f0ab7da4314087d9379451ea97abb
|
||
李玉
|
||
ou_92127a3f33b1d4aaac4979a101735ff9
|
||
姜小龙
|
||
ou_e286f90e5e6835c16c1f01c87def550b
|
||
李丹
|
||
ou_92792ceb9bab57c991c8e0d0e49c5411
|
||
梁音
|
||
ou_657580c2126becc2ae8ef39089b9478e
|
||
assistant: 已全部补齐,现在 USER.md 中所有用户的 user_id 和 open_id 都完整了,没有"待补全"的了。
|
||
user: [message_id: om_x100b6cfe455a84b8b14a433ea0a87c1]
|
||
李承龙: 后续,我们在校验用户数据权限时,优先获取用户的user_id
|
||
assistant: 明白,后续校验用户数据权限时优先获取 user_id 进行匹配。这个规则我记下了,和现有的身份识别逻辑一致(user_id 是租户级唯一,最稳定)。
|
||
|
||
如果拿到的是 open_id,就通过 USER.md 中的对照表反查对应的 user_id,再做权限判断。
|